Specialists in Asia? Chiari getting worse.

Hi. I was diagnosed with Chiari almost 4 years ago, but, at the time, hadn't had any major life alternating symptoms...the most annoying ones probably being my horrible balance, headaches, and dizziness/"seeing stars" when moving my head too quickly.
Everything was fine, so I decided to take a teaching job in China and moved here August of last year. Lately, I've been experiencing some worrisome changes in my symptoms. My toes and bottom of my feet are becoming numb several times in a day. I have also been experiencing more back, neck and shoulder pain. I really noticed it after yoga two nights ago..the pain lasted for a day, off and on. My throat has gotten worse as well. I remember last year singing with the kids (I teach grade one) during class, but now I find it extremely difficult because my throat will get this annoying "tickle" or scratchy feeling and I will have to drink a lot of water.
So, I want to get another MRI to see if my herniation or the syprinx (that they claimed was on my spine, but not a big worry at that moment) has gotten bigger. I've only had that one MRI about 3 and a half years ago..and I know, I should be getting them regularly. My question is: does anyone know any Chiari Specialists anywhere in Asia? I'd be willing to go almost anywhere, as flights are rather cheap from here. I'm afraid to just go to a regular neurologist here in Guangzhou, China...I'm not sure how reliable they will be. I really hope someone can help me out. Thanks!
